Metal Ghost Posted January 6, 2014 Share Posted January 6, 2014 Agreed with posts above. Also, I've spent a lot of time playing Rayman: Legends with my girls as well and have had a blast with it. We played through Rayman: Origins last year on Xbox 360, so this was an easy choice for us. I will say that if you're going to play it primarily solo, one of the other versions (Xbox 360 or PS3 I believe are the other choices) may be the better option, as the Wii U version forces you to play as character Murphy sometimes, which may not be everyone's thing. DaytonaUSA Posted January 10, 2014 Share Posted January 10, 2014 I'd say you got the best that's out there atm, other than New Super Mario Bros U (though don't expect anything groundbreaking with that title). I wouldn't go for NFS, personally. The lack of anti-aliasing makes anything in the background look like it's built of freakin' legos. Seriously. There's other issues with it too, but that's the one that bugs me the most. Honestly, DK, MK, and SSB are your best bets for this year so far at least. I know you want to get tons of games for your new system (I know the feeling), but honestly at this point, there's not much more to recommend that's really worth your time. Well, that is if you have a 360 or PS3 already. If not, there are many third party games at your disposal that are a bit gimped. If anyone recommends Wonderful 101, I'd consider trying the demo or giving it a rent before purchase. It's kinda polarizing. Some love it, some hate it. Not many in-between.
